What Does "OTP Verified" Really Mean?
When you get an "OTP Verified" confirmation, what does it truly signify ? Essentially, it’s a protection measure designed to ensure that you are the individual you claim to whatsapp otp buy be. OTP, or One-Time Password, is a singular code delivered to your designated mobile device or email account. This code is valid for a short period, causing it exceptionally difficult for scammers to compromise your profile . It’s a level of two-factor verification , adding an additional process beyond your password.

Best Practices for OTP Verification Security
Securing your one-time password authentication process requires several steps . First, consistently utilize rate throttling to prevent brute-force tries . Furthermore , do not send OTPs via regular correspondence - SMS or a dedicated app are recommended . Consider integrating time-based codes (TOTP) for enhanced security measures . Finally, inform your clients about phishing scams and urge them to under no circumstances share their OTPs with others.
